2011-11-22 3 views
6

.apkファイルのバックアップを作成できるアプリからアンドロイドアプリを防止する方法。.apkバックアップアプリからアンドロイドアプリを保護する方法

astro file managerのようなアプリでは、メニュー:ツール - >バックアップmore info here のように、インストールされたapkをsdcardにバックアップできます。後で

、私はそれを.zipファイルおよび抽出するために、その名前を変更することができ、簡単にそのアプリから引き出し可能/ ASSET を盗むことができます。

私の質問は、どのように私はそのようなバックアップから私のアプリを保護するのですか?

答えて

2

私が知る限り、これを止める完全な方法はありません。しかし、それでも私は自分のアプリから何かを盗もうとするかどうか本当に気にしているかどうか試してみる前に、常に自分自身に尋ねるだろう。すべてのデータが安全であることを確認するために努力します。

+0

に内側に、彼らはファイルを見ることができない、彼らはAPKを開けていてもprogaurd使用するようにしてください。 しかし、これは他の開発者の心配かもしれません。これはアンドロイドビルドが欠けているものです。 私は資産の重要なデータファイルを暗号化する技術を知っています。 –

+0

@piyushnpの資産の暗号化は問題ありませんが、私たちはassestsフォルダのランタイムを変更することはできません。 –

0

これを行う方法はありません。あなたのAPK内のものは取ることができます。実行時にドロウアブルを生成することも、サーバからプルすることもできますが、これは価値がありますか?優れたツールの1つが「弁護士」と呼ばれる著作権で保護されたコンテンツの盗みに対処するより良い方法がある

0

本当にユーザーが自分のPCにapkをコピーして開くことを禁止する方法はありません。

3

答えが真実ではないということです。市場で古いコピープロテクションを使用するようにアプリを設定した場合(チェックボックスはまだ表示されています)、APKを読み取るにはルート付き電話が必要です。また、私は最近(ICE、緊急の場合)、私はバックアップすることができなかったと私はそれが古いコピープロテクションを使用していないと思うアプリケーションを見てきました。私はそれがどのようにしているのか分かりません。 また、資産を「盗む」問題でもなく、無関係です。クラッカーにとって、余分なステップごとに、彼が自分の道で見つけたすべての迷惑は、あなたのアプリを裂くための彼の決断を弱体化する。 1つの決定されたクラッカーだけが、何千もの海賊のコピーをローミングする必要があり、そのようなことは起こりたくありません。

0

が行われるように仕事を集中での努力を置くために、私は同意すること

関連する問題